Millennials on the Move
The millennial generation is defined as individuals born between 1981 and 1996. This group has represented the largest share of the homebuying market for the past five years in a row, with the 2018 share at 36%, according to Anna DeSimone, housing advocate and author of “Housing Finance 2020.” Even though millennials make up a […]

Deschutes Shifts Gears with its Roanoke Brewery
The Deschutes Brewery facility planned for construction in Roanoke, Va. isn’t off the tableโbut plans have changed a bit. Instead of striking a deal with the City of Roanoke to get its land for free, the Bend-based company is going to buy the land outright. In 2016, the craft brewer announced that it would build […]
